Have you ever gotten out of the shower, dried off and just had to get out of the bathroom for a few minutes because it was so hot, humid and uncomfortable?   I mean, you can’t get dressed when you’re hot like that. You know what could help minimize that problem?   A powerful, bathroom exhaust fan.  Powerful, but quiet, because if the fan is annoyingly loud, you won’t use it regularly.  Choosing the right fan for your bathroom is more important than you might think.  Without an appropriately sized exhaust fan, not only can your bathroom be uncomfortably hot and humid, not to mention smelly, but over time, you risk causing moisture damage to your bathroom drywall and cabinetry.  Plus you increase your chances of developing mold and mildew on your shower walls, drywall, and even on the wood framing beneath the drywall.
